  • How much difference does a projector screen make? Is there a big difference between a $400 screen and a $1300 screen? I tested 8 ultra short throw projector screens to see which one had the best brightness, contrast, black levels, clarity, and ambient light rejection.

    Great work and finally someone that review CLR and ALR screens for laser ust projectors, much appreciated! But i missing 3 brands... The MirraViz, Screen Innovations (SI) and BORDER REEN-X screens. It would be great if you would test this in the near future.

    • @TheHookUp
      @TheHookUp  Před rokem +1

      MirraViz doesn't have a tensioned version yet and their previous version suffers is not an option for most people because the seams between the individual panels are clearly visible, and because the adhesive transfers imperfections from the wall onto the screen. When they release their tensioned version I'll be sure to review it. I did reach out to Screen Innovations, but they did not respond. I've never heard of BORDER REEN-X, looks like an indiegogo screen?
